Has anyone heard of or had experience with lymphoma being linked with radiation exposure?
My husband was on the nuclear powered cruiser in the 1960′s. He now has lymphoma. I can’t find any information on the possible link. He was a cook and a shop keeper on the ship, but he does remember picking up the mail from the top of the reactor, so I know he was around it at times.
The causes of lymphoma are still unknown. It could be a mere coincidence. The only way to establish a possible link would be if more than a handful of people on the ship went on to develop lymphoma. If not, then it is more than likely to be a coincidence
